Lithium battery failure sparks early-morning South Floyd Street fire

LOUISVILLE, Ky. (WDRB) — Two people were injured and four were displaced after a structure fire on South Floyd Street early Friday morning.

According to a release from the Louisville Fire Department, crews were dispatched at 1:33 a.m. to a reported fire in the 1200 block of S. Floyd Street.

When crews arrived on scene at 1:38 a.m., they found a two-story brick storefront with “heavy fire involvement” on the second floor…
